Codecondo

Valuable Careers: How Developers Stay Relevant for 10 Years

Valuable Careers

Introduction

Valuable careers are built with intention. They require a shift from reactive learning to structured growth, from short-term gains to long-term impact. Understanding how to create such a career is essential for anyone aiming for sustained success in tech.

The technology industry evolves faster than almost any other field. New frameworks replace old ones, tools become obsolete, and entire paradigms shift within just a few years. In such a rapidly changing environment, many developers struggle with a critical question: how do you build a career that stays valuable for the next 10 years?

The answer lies not in chasing trends, but in building valuable careers based on long-term thinking, adaptability, and strategic skill development. Developers who remain relevant over a decade are not necessarily the ones who know the latest tools—they are the ones who understand how to grow consistently despite change.

1. Why Most Developer Careers Lose Value Over Time

Over-reliance on specific tools
Failure to adapt to change
Lack of long-term strategy

Many careers stagnate because they are built on short-term decisions rather than long-term planning.

2. What Defines Valuable Careers in Tech

Longevity of skills
Adaptability to change
Consistent professional growth

Valuable careers are not defined by job titles, but by sustained relevance.

3. The Role of Career Planning

Developers who think long-term make better decisions early in their careers. Understanding career planning vs role chasing in tech highlights why structured growth is essential for building lasting value.

4. Moving Beyond Tool Dependency

Tools change rapidly
Concepts remain stable
Fundamentals outlast trends

Relying too heavily on tools can make skills obsolete quickly.

5. Building Skills That Stand the Test of Time

Focusing on long-term skill relevance is critical. Learning from career skills that stay relevant helps developers prioritize what truly matters for sustained success.

6. The Importance of Core Fundamentals

Data structures and algorithms
System design principles
Problem-solving skills

Fundamentals provide a strong foundation that supports long-term growth.

7. Adaptability as a Core Skill

Ability to learn new technologies quickly
Comfort with change
Continuous improvement mindset

Adaptability is one of the most important traits for maintaining valuable careers.

8. Continuous Learning Without Overwhelm

Focus on relevant skills
Avoid unnecessary distractions
Learn with purpose

Learning should be strategic, not reactive.

9. The Role of Soft Skills in Long-Term Value

Technical skills may get you hired, but soft skills sustain your career. Developing essential soft skills for long-term career success ensures that developers remain valuable beyond technical expertise.

10. Avoiding the Trap of Trend Chasing

Jumping between technologies
Following hype cycles
Losing focus on core growth

Trend chasing often leads to fragmented knowledge.

11. Building Deep Expertise

Mastering key areas
Developing specialization
Creating authority in a domain

Depth of knowledge increases long-term career value.

12. Creating a Consistent Learning System

Scheduled learning time
Clear goals
Measurable progress

Consistency is more effective than sporadic effort.

13. The Power of System-Level Thinking

Understanding how systems work
Connecting different technologies
Seeing the bigger picture

System-level thinking improves problem-solving and adaptability.

14. Long-Term Career Positioning

Choosing roles strategically
Aligning work with goals
Building relevant experience

Career positioning determines future opportunities.

15. The Importance of Real-World Experience

Hands-on projects
Practical problem-solving
Continuous application of knowledge

Experience reinforces learning and builds credibility.

16. Maintaining Relevance in a Changing Industry

Stay updated without overcommitting
Focus on transferable skills
Adapt to industry shifts

Relevance comes from flexibility, not constant change.

17. Avoiding Career Burnout

Balance work and learning
Set realistic expectations
Prioritize well-being

Sustainable growth is key to long-term success.

18. Building a Strong Professional Identity

Clear expertise
Consistent career narrative
Recognizable value

A strong identity helps developers stand out.

19. Measuring Career Growth Over Time

Skill improvement
Project complexity
Impact on organizations

Tracking progress ensures continuous growth.

20. Why Valuable Careers Are Built, Not Found

Intentional decisions
Consistent effort
Long-term focus

Valuable careers are the result of deliberate planning and sustained effort.

Conclusion

Building a career that remains valuable for 10 years is not about chasing every new trend or constantly switching roles. It is about creating a strong foundation, developing relevant skills, and maintaining the ability to adapt to change.

Developers who succeed in the long term focus on fundamentals, build deep expertise, and approach their careers with a clear strategy. They understand that value comes from consistency, not intensity, and from direction, not randomness.

In a constantly evolving industry, the key to staying relevant is not to predict the future perfectly, but to prepare for it intelligently. Valuable

Exit mobile version